Multiple Monitors in Display Properties
Your system has one video connector on the back panel. The video driver installed in your system is
designed to be used with various Dell™ systems, some of which have front- and back-panel video
connectors. This causes the Microsoft Windows Server 2003 operating system to report that the
system is configured to display on multiple monitors.
To check your display settings:
1
Right-click your desktop and click
Properties
.
2
Click the
Settings
tab and verify that the display mode is set to
(Multiple Monitors)
on RADEON 7000 SERIES
.
The video driver also causes Windows Server 2003 to display the monitor that is attached to your
system’s video connector, as well as to reserve a "default monitor" as a placeholder for systems that
have two video connectors.
To view the list of monitors:
1
Right-click your desktop and click
Properties
.
2
Click the
Settings
tab, and then click the
Advanced
button.
